Texture inhomogeneity in titanium deformed by ECAP
Abstract
Titanium of commercial purity was deformed by equal channel angular pressing (ECAP) with back-pressure at 380 degrees C using 4 passes of route B-C. Billets of 120 min length were pressed at 0.4 min s(-1) through square channels (14 mm x 14 mm) intersecting sharply at an angle of 90 degrees. The global texture measurements of the starting and ECAP processed material were done by neutron diffraction. To investigate the texture inhomogencity after ECAP the local texture was measured with high-energy synchrotron radiation at different positions in the cross-section of the billet. The texture gradient with regard to intensity and orientation of the dominant texture component is characterized and discussed.
